With the retirement of Kathryn Fitzsimmons as editor of Quaternary
Australasia this year, a new co-editor for this esteemed publication is
needed. This is a fantastic chance to get experience in editing a journal
and making a mark on how Australasian Quaternary science is viewed and
remembered. Please get in touch by email if you are interested or would
like to know more about the role (please contact us at editor at aqua.org.au).
No previous experience in editing is needed. The role involves close
teamwork with the co-editor (presently Pia Atahan) regarding content,
soliciting contributions such as conference reports, opinion pieces, and
thesis abstracts, facilitating the peer review process for research
articles, proof reading and liaison with graphic designers and printers.
You will also sit on the AQUA Executive Committee.
Support will be provided by the current co-editor Pia Atahan, who will
continue to share the role. Mentoring will be available from Kathryn
Fitzsimmons during the settling in period.
